How much do parttime java software engineer j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 14, 2026, the average hourly pay for parttime java software engineer in Fort Lauderdale, FL is $57.76,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$47.55 and $65.24 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Will AI replace Java devs?

AI tools can automate certain coding tasks and improve efficiency for Java software engineers, but they are unlikely to fully replace Java developers. Skilled Java developers are needed to design, implement, and maintain complex systems, as well as to adapt AI-generated code to specific project requirements. Continuous learning and expertise in programming concepts remain essential in this field.

Can I get a job with just Java?

A Part-time Java Software Engineer role typically requires proficiency in Java programming, but employers often look for additional skills such as knowledge of frameworks, version control, and problem-solving abilities. Having experience with related tools and certifications can improve job prospects, but relying solely on Java may limit opportunities, as many roles also require understanding of software development processes and other technologies.

Is Java outdated in 2026?

Java remains a widely used programming language in 2026, especially for enterprise applications, backend development, and Android app creation. As a parttime Java software engineer, staying updated with the latest Java versions and frameworks is important to remain competitive in the job market.

Position Overview
Adjunct Faculty members teach IT and Computer Science and Information Technology courses to students pursuing a broad range of Associate in Arts, or Associate in Science degrees.
Courses may be taught in an array of teaching modalities: MDC In-Person, MDC Live (Learning Interactively in a Virtual Environment), MDC Online (online delivery) and Blended Classes .
What you will be doing
  • Teaches lecture and laboratory sections
  • Evaluates and advises students
  • Participates in departmental and College affairs
  • Develops curricula
  • Recruits students
  • Serves on committees
  • Performs other duties as assigned
What you need to succeed
  • Doctorate or Master's degree in Computer Science or related field (e.g., Information Technology, Networking and Telecommunications, Management Information Systems, Software Engineering, Computer Engineering); or Master's degree and 18 graduate semester hours in Computer Science; Computer, Electrical or Electronics Engineering or related field (e.g. Information Technology, Networking and Telecommunications, Management Information Systems, Software Engineering, Computer Engineering)
  • Flexibility to teach off site with industry partners
  • Ability to work Monday through Thursday between the hours of 3:00 pm to 11:00 pm
  • Ability to provide both theoretical and hand on instruction in the classroom
  • Ability to work well with students, faculty and staff
